Philly Made is a foundation that supports underprivileged youth in the Philadelphia, South Jersey, and Montgomery County areas by creating career and economic opportunities for them. Our main program, the C-Tech Training program, offers a comprehensive curriculum that covers job training courses such as structured wiring training, telecommunications certifications, computer skills, Microsoft Office training, and business management courses. 

 

Our mission is to train the future workforce with valuable skills that are not easily replaced by automation. We focus on telecommunications technologies, network cabling (both copper-based systems and fiber optics-based systems), home entertainment residential audio/video systems, wireless systems, grounding, and bonding for copper systems, and also provide education on entrepreneurship with a monthly recurring revenue (MRR) structure and becoming a managed solution provider business. We aim to prepare individuals to succeed in today's digital world. 

 

After completing our 3-month certificate program, graduates will have industry-standard certifications and the necessary knowledge to pursue various careers in technology. We also strive to build partnerships with local companies who need skilled workers.
